NEW HOLLAND BLUE GOAT DOPPELBOCK
Fab Michigan brewer turns to Rogue-like embossed label with Stone-y side parable for busy ruby chestnut-hued full body. Though only its minor sugarplum sweetness and stewed prune seduction seem specifically bock-like, there’s no denying thick chocolate-y vanilla incline and fitting hazelnut-almond influence. Caramelized barleymalt base deepens butterscotch-maple trench guarding fruitcake-like fig-date finish.

AVENTINUS WHEAT DOPPELBOCK
Luminous auburn-clouded bock registers up-front burgundy wanderlust furthered by musty Muscat grape pungency, leathered banana-clove perk, cotton-candied bubblegum sweetness, rich plum-prune tartness, mild grape skin tannins and dewy cellar fungi. Perfumed hop insistence delicately nudges honey nut-roasted pale-crystal malting and sweet toffee-butterscotch-vanilla subsidy, culminating in creamy barleywine resonance. Not as heavily alcoholic as stronger doppelbocks, yet rich, assertive, stimulating. Aged four years and quaffed on tap at Ambulance, busy 2013 version gained mellow caramelized malt syruping and pronounced red cherry, cantaloupe, banana daiquiri and honeydew sweetness.
PENNICHUCK SAINT FLORIAN DOPPELBOCK LAGER
Excuse doppelbock descriptive and re-label this full-bodied lager a buttery Flemish ale/ toasted lager blend. Its chewy brown sugared marzipan opening and oncoming brown chocolate-y toffee sweetness pile-drive minor cocoa-powdered bittering to ripe raisin finish. Recessive hazelnut illusions linger below. Brewery defunct: 2010.
